In the sixth episode of 'Ay, Future', Martín Caparrós reflects on those “cages” in which we live now


“We live tight, cramped, all together.”

This is how journalist Martín Caparrós defines the way we live now, comparing the buildings that flood cities to cages.

In his sixth installment of

Ay, Future

, 'We are citizens', once again, supported by the illustrations of Miguel Rep, reflects on how new techniques allow us to do many things together without being together.

“Will we all end up living alone in huge cities?” Caparrós asks.

The visual column of the Argentine couple has a total of eight installments that premiere every Sunday in EL PAÍS.

In previous episodes, they have discussed issues such as freedom in sex, world hunger or the ability to cheat death.
